💶 Current Property Prices and Market Insights in Castel Maggiore

The real estate market in Castel Maggiore presents varied opportunities for buyers. The average price per square meter is around €2,200-€2,800, with fluctuations depending on the district:

  • Centro Storico: Properties can range from €3,000 to €4,500 per square meter, reflecting high demand for historic homes with modern amenities.
  • Villafontana: Prices here range from €2,100 to €2,600, appealing to both investors and private buyers alike.
  • Castel Maggiore Nord: Approximately €2,000 to €2,400 per square meter, ideal for families seeking larger residences.

Property types vary widely, ranging from apartments and townhouses to single-family homes and commercial units. New developments in Castel Maggiore are particularly attractive as they offer modern design and contemporary amenities. Additionally, recent price dynamics show a steady growth rate of 3-5% annually, reflecting the city’s increasing popularity as an investment destination.

🚆 Transport and Connectivity in Castel Maggiore

Connectivity is one of Castel Maggiore’s notable strengths. The city features a well-established public transport system, including buses and trams, providing easy access to Bologna and surrounding areas. The average travel time to Bologna city center is approximately 15-25 minutes, which considerably enhances the appeal for commuters.

Key transport highlights include:

  • Bologna Centrale Station: Just a short bus ride away, offering connections to national and international destinations.
  • Highway Access: The nearby A13 and A14 motorways provide convenient road access for those driving, making Castel Maggiore an ideal residence for business professionals.

Moreover, cycling is popular in Castel Maggiore, thanks to dedicated bike lanes that support sustainable transportation.

💳 Financing and Mortgage Options for Castel Maggiore Properties

Financing options in Castel Maggiore are accessible for both Italian and foreign buyers. Typical down payments range from 20-30%, making property investment feasible for many. Additionally, interest rates are competitive, generally around 1-3% for residential properties.

For those looking into developer plans, many offer installment payment options that allow buyers to manage their budgets effectively. This flexibility can make owning property in Castel Maggiore even more appealing.

📝 Property Purchase Process for Foreigners in Castel Maggiore

The property purchase process in Castel Maggiore for foreigners is straightforward. A quick overview of the steps includes:

  1. Consultation with Real Estate Agents: Engaging local agents helps in understanding market trends and identifying suitable properties.
  2. Securing Financing: Pre-approval from a bank will streamline the purchasing experience.
  3. Appointment with a Notary: This legal professional facilitates the contract signing and ensures all documentation is accurate.
  4. Final Payment and Registration: Once payment is complete, the property registration with the land registry is finalized.

These steps ensure a smooth buying experience but consulting professionals is advisable.

⚖️ Legal Aspects and Residence Options for Buyers in Castel Maggiore

Foreign buyers can own property in Castel Maggiore without major restrictions. Legal aspects involve understanding the local taxes, such as the Imposta di Registro and ongoing property taxes, which are manageable.

For buyers considering relocation, Castel Maggiore offers options for residence permits, especially for those purchasing significant investments or launching businesses.

What charges and duties when purchasing property in Castel Maggiore?

During the process of buying property in Castel Maggiore, certain taxes and related charges apply. The key payment is the ownership transfer tax, the rate of which is typically 3–6 percent of the purchase price. Besides the tax, a notary and registration fee is charged. When a real estate agency is involved, an agent’s commission may be charged. In certain regions, a property tax may apply, which is calculated based on cadastral value. Thus, all taxes and fees usually amount to up to 10 percent of the purchase cost.
